It is really annoying to have my view of the speedometer obstructed when I'm driving. I have to frequently shift my position to see it and often drive too slow or too fast because it's not easily seen. It would be a simple fix for future models to switch the speedometer gauge with the RPM dial in the lower dash, I can see that one much better. I hope it's fixed by 2016 when I return my lease...I would like to get another Honda, so far this is my only complaint.
